Greptile 개요
Greptile이란 무엇인가요?
Greptile은 GitHub 및 GitLab에서 풀 리퀘스트(PR) 검토 프로세스를 자동화하고 개선하도록 설계된 AI 기반 코드 검토 도구입니다. 컨텍스트 인식 피드백을 제공하고, 더 많은 버그를 찾아내고, 소프트웨어 개발 팀의 병합 시간을 단축하는 데 탁월합니다.
Greptile은 어떻게 작동하나요?
Greptile은 전체 코드베이스에 대한 포괄적인 이해를 바탕으로 풀 리퀘스트를 분석하여 작동합니다. 피상적인 분석을 제공하는 많은 도구와 달리 Greptile은 코드베이스의 상세한 그래프를 구성하여 다양한 구성 요소가 어떻게 상호 작용하는지 파악합니다. 이를 통해 더 정확하고 관련성 높으며 실행 가능한 피드백을 제공할 수 있습니다.
다음은 핵심 기능에 대한 분석입니다.
- 인라인 댓글 및 제안: Greptile은 버그, 안티 패턴 및 잠재적 문제를 식별하기 위해 PR 내에 직접 컨텍스트 인식 댓글을 추가합니다. 이러한 댓글은 개발자가 코드를 최대 80% 더 빠르게 병합하는 데 도움이 될 수 있습니다.
- 맞춤형 컨텍스트: 이 도구는 팀의 특정 코딩 표준에 맞는 지능적인 제안을 제공합니다. 개발자는 이러한 제안을 빠르게 수락하여 사소한 문제를 해결하고 코드 일관성을 보장할 수 있습니다.
- PR 요약: Greptile은 Mermaid 다이어그램, 파일별 분석 및 신뢰도 점수를 포함하는 지능형 PR 요약을 생성합니다. 이를 통해 팀은 더 큰 확신을 가지고 코드를 배송할 수 있습니다.
- 학습: Greptile의 고유한 기능 중 하나는 사용자 상호 작용을 통해 학습하는 능력입니다. 개발자가 도구를 사용함에 따라 댓글, 응답 및 피드백에서 새로운 규칙과 코딩 특성을 추론하여 시간이 지남에 따라 제안을 조정합니다.
주요 기능 및 이점:
- 3배 더 많은 버그 포착: 전체 코드베이스 컨텍스트를 이해함으로써 Greptile은 다른 도구가 놓칠 수 있는 문제를 식별할 수 있습니다.
- PR 병합 속도 4배 향상: 자동화된 검토 프로세스 및 지능형 제안은 코드 검토 및 병합에 필요한 시간을 크게 줄입니다.
- 100% 코드베이스 컨텍스트: 많은 도구와 달리 Greptile은 코드베이스의 상세한 그래프를 생성하고 모든 것이 어떻게 연결되는지 이해합니다.
- 30개 이상의 언어 지원: Greptile은 Python, JavaScript, TypeScript, Go, Elixir, Java, C, C++, C#, Swift, PHP 및 Rust를 포함한 광범위한 프로그래밍 언어를 지원합니다.
Greptile을 선택해야 하는 이유?
- 향상된 코드 품질: Greptile은 개발 프로세스 초기에 버그, 안티 패턴 및 잠재적 문제를 식별하여 팀이 높은 코드 품질을 유지하도록 돕습니다.
- 향상된 효율성: PR 검토 프로세스를 자동화함으로써 Greptile은 개발자가 더 높은 수준의 설계 및 아키텍처 작업에 집중할 수 있도록 합니다.
- 향상된 일관성: 팀의 코딩 표준을 학습하고 적응하는 도구의 기능은 프로젝트 전반에 걸쳐 코드 일관성을 보장합니다.
Greptile은 누구를 위한 것인가요?
Greptile은 다음에 이상적입니다.
- 스타트업에서 엔터프라이즈에 이르기까지 모든 규모의 소프트웨어 개발 팀.
- 코드 품질 및 효율성을 우선시하는 조직.
- 버전 제어를 위해 GitHub 또는 GitLab을 사용하는 팀.
Greptile 사용 방법?
- 통합: Greptile은 GitHub 및 GitLab과 원활하게 통합됩니다.
- PR 분석: 풀 리퀘스트가 생성되면 Greptile은 코드 변경 사항을 자동으로 분석합니다.
- 피드백: Greptile은 인라인 댓글, 제안 및 PR 요약을 제공합니다.
- 학습: Greptile은 사용자 상호 작용을 통해 학습하여 시간이 지남에 따라 제안을 개선합니다.
보안 및 규정 준수:
Greptile은 다음과 같은 기능으로 보안을 우선시합니다.
- 자체 호스팅 배포: 인프라를 완벽하게 제어하기 위해 자체 에어 갭 환경에 Greptile을 배포할 수 있습니다.
- SOC 2 규정 준수: 모든 데이터는 업계 표준 암호화 및 보안 관행을 사용하여 저장 및 전송 중에 암호화됩니다.
추천사:
Greptile을 사용하는 개발자는 인간 검토자가 종종 놓치는 문제를 찾아내고 높은 수준의 제안을 제공하는 능력에 대해 극찬합니다.
- “우리의 기술 스택은 AI가 파악하기 어렵다는 것을 반복적으로 입증했지만 Greptile은 우수한 신호 대 잡음비로 일관된 검토 통찰력을 제공하여 가장 까다로운 엔지니어까지 설득했습니다.” - Jarrod, Principal Engineer, Brex
- “Greptile의 코드 검토 품질에 깊은 인상을 받았습니다. 피드백 루프를 강화하고 일관성을 개선했으며 엔지니어가 더 높은 수준의 설계 및 아키텍처에 집중할 수 있도록 해방했습니다.” - Mark, Eng. Manager, WorkOS
- “Greptile은 제가 사용해본 AI 코드 검토 도구 중 가장 인상적인 도구 중 하나입니다. 게임을 바꾸는 데 있어서는 Cursor와 어깨를 나란히 합니다.” - Martin, CTO, PurpleFish
가격 책정
Greptile은 간단한 가격 책정 모델을 제공합니다.
- 코드 검토: 개발자 1인당 월 $30.
- 채팅: 고정 월간 구독.
- API 가격 책정: 요청당. 할인된 대량 가격은 Greptile에 문의하십시오.
결론
Greptile은 GitHub 및 GitLab에서 풀 리퀘스트(PR) 검토 프로세스를 자동화하고 개선하도록 설계된 AI 코드 검토 도구입니다. 코드 품질을 개선하고 효율성을 높이며 일관성을 유지하려는 소프트웨어 개발 팀에게 유용한 도구입니다. Greptile은 3배 더 많은 버그를 포착하고 PR 병합 속도를 4배 향상시키는 데 도움이 될 수 있습니다. 학습 기능, 보안 기능 및 긍정적인 추천사를 통해 Greptile은 개발 워크플로를 최적화하려는 모든 팀에게 고려할 가치가 있습니다. 코드 검토 프로세스를 자동화함으로써 Greptile은 개발자가 보다 전략적인 작업에 집중할 수 있도록 하여 혁신을 주도하고 고품질 소프트웨어를 더 빠르게 제공합니다.
"Greptile"의 최고의 대체 도구
Ellipsis는 버그 탐지를 자동화하고 질문에 답변하며 테스트된 코드를 생성하는 AI 코드 검토 도구입니다. 여러 언어를 지원하고 GitHub와 통합되어 개발자 생산성을 향상시킵니다.
Sourcery는 GitHub, GitLab 및 IDE에서 코드 검토를 자동화하는 AI 기반 코드 검토 도구입니다. 피드백을 제공하고 버그 및 보안 문제를 조기에 식별하여 팀이 더 빠르게 움직일 수 있도록 지원합니다.
Codoki는 팀이 더 빠르고 적은 버그로 코드를 배송할 수 있도록 지원하는 AI 기반 코드 검토 도구입니다. 몇 초 안에 풀 요청을 분석하고 AI, 정적 및 동적 분석을 통해 프로덕션에 도달하기 전에 문제의 92%를 포착합니다.
Kamara AI는 개발 팀이 코드 품질을 개선하고, 워크플로 속도를 높이고, 기관 지식을 보존하는 데 도움이 되는 AI 기반 GitHub 앱입니다. AI 기반 코드 검토 및 풀 리퀘스트 구현.
CodeAnt AI는 팀이 수동 검토 시간과 버그를 50% 줄이는 데 도움이 되는 AI 기반 코드 검토 플랫폼입니다. 코드 보안, 품질 분석 및 보안 검사를 제공하며 빠르게 움직이는 팀을 위해 구축되었습니다.
CodeRabbit은 95 % 이상의 버그를 잡아내는 AI 기반 코드 검토를 제공하여 개발자가 코드를 더 빨리 제공 할 수 있도록합니다. 자동 보고서, PR 요약 등을 얻으십시오.
Ellipsis를 사용하여 코드 검토를 자동화하세요. 버그를 찾고, 질문에 답변하고, 테스트된 코드를 생성하는 AI 도구입니다. AI를 통해 소프트웨어 엔지니어의 생산성을 높이세요.
CodeMate AI는 개발자가 더 빠르게 코딩하고, 오류를 디버깅하고, 코드 검토를 자동화하도록 설계된 AI 기반 코딩 도우미입니다. VS Code와 통합되고 여러 버전 제어 시스템을 지원합니다.
Korbit AI는 GitHub, GitLab 및 Bitbucket을 위한 AI 코드 검토 도구로, 검토 주기를 가속화하고 코드 품질을 향상시킵니다. AI 기반 PR 검토를 통해 버그 및 취약점을 조기에 감지하십시오.
Kypso는 엔지니어링 리더가 AI 챔피언으로 팀 프로세스를 변환하고, 작업을 자동화하고, 워크플로를 간소화하도록 설계된 AI 플랫폼입니다.
GitLoop: 코드베이스와 채팅하고, 문서를 생성하고, 단위 테스트를 수행하고, 코드를 원활하게 검토할 수 있도록 Git 리포지토리를 위한 컨텍스트 인식 AI 도우미입니다.
GitChat by Locale.ai를 사용하여 코드 품질을 개선하고 버그를 더 빠르게 감지하세요. 효율적인 코드 검토를 위한 AI 기반 요약 및 실시간 채팅.
Lancey는 AI 에이전트를 사용하여 지원 채널과 리포지토리를 모니터링한 다음 병합 준비가 완료된 PR을 작성합니다. 버그 수정 및 코드 검토를 자동화하여 개발자 생산성을 높입니다.
CodeReviewBot.ai는 GitHub pull requests와 통합되어 버그 감지, 보안 검사 및 성능 개선을 자동화하여 코딩 효율성을 향상시키는 AI 기반 코드 검토 서비스입니다.